摘要: 本试验选用1~3胎次患有隐性乳房炎的体重600 kg泌乳荷斯坦牛36头,随机均分为对照组和试验组,试验组奶牛每天服用200 g的红岩草提取物。乳酶活性测定结果表明,试验7 d组和14 d组的髓过氧化物酶(MPO)、乳酸脱氢酶(LDH)、乳过氧化物酶(LP)、N-乙酰-B-氨基葡糖糖苷酶(NAG)活性均极显著低于对照组(P<0.01);CMT法检测结果表明,试验7 d组和14 d组的治愈率分别为55.56%和77.78%;药物安全性评价结果表明,本试验中的红岩草提取物添加量并未造成试验7 d和14 d组奶牛的肝脏、肾脏功能指标变化,具有较高的安全性,可用于兽医临床。

Abstract: The 36 subclinical mastitis dairy cows of 600 kg weight and 1 to 3 parity were selected for the experiment,and randomly distributed equally into control group and test group. The test group dairy cows were taking 200 g of extract of saxifrage daily. Results showed that enzyme activity of myeloperoxidase enzyme (MPO), lactate dehydrogenase (LDH), lactoperoxidase (LP) and N-acetyl-B-amino-glucosidase (NAG) in the test group 7 and 14 d were significantly lower than the control group(P<0.01); CMT assay showed that the cure rates of test group 7 and 14 d were 55.56% and 77.78%, respectively; drug safety evaluation showed that using the extract of saxifrage had not cause changes in liver and kidney function indicators in test group 7 and 14 d, it indicated that the extract of saxifrage could be used in veterinary clinic safely.
